The Providence Bruins are in round 2 of the Atlantic Division Finals. Games 1 and 2 were this weekend in Providence.

Saturday night the PB's took on the Portland Pirates. The crowd was pretty decent with a smidge over 3900 in attendance. The atmosphere was great and the Bruins ended up winning the game 4-0. They had 40 shots on goal. There were three decent fights and they were the kind of fights were the guys really hated each other. They had that look of fire in their eyes. Bruins tough guy Steve MacIntyre took on Mike Hoffman and what made this fight odd was that Hoffman left his right glove on. He landed one or two but "Mac Attack" (I didn't call him that..the other ticket holders near me do/did) went nuts at the end and took him out. There were 44 minutes of penalties in the third period alone. A great fun game and we left on a high note.

Sunday afternoon the teams faced off again and this didn't take long to get out of hand (scoring wise). 3300+ took in this game and were treated to a 7-1 Prov Win. Providence goalie Tuukka Rask was hardly tested. The down side was about 1/2 way into the third he lost his shut out. At that time he has only 12 shots taken on him. Under worked perhaps? Martins Karsums had a hat trick and it seemed like everyone was getting on the score sheet. The team sort of coasted thru the third, but they scored 4 goals in that period. It sounds odd, but it seemed over well before that.

The teams head to Portland for games 3,4 and 5. Hopefully I won't have another game until we are on to the next round.
